Important systems like power grids, transportation networks, and water supplies are essential for modern life. However, they are at risk from cyberattacks, which can threaten national security, the economy, and public safety. InfraGuard, a partnership between the FBI and private companies, helps protect these systems by using advanced tools to detect cyber threats instantly and respond automatically. This paper looks at how InfraGuard improves the security of these vital systems by using the latest technology to spot cyber dangers quickly and reduce risks through automated actions. We also study InfraGuard's setup, tools, abilities, and how well it works as part of the country's plan to protect against cyber threats.
